- [ ] Step 7: Archive cold storage buckets (Glacierline tier). Confirm both ceremony witnesses are present, verify bucket manifests match the Oxbow ledger, then seal the archive key shares. Plugin authors may observe but not handle shares. Once sealed, the archive index itself is encrypted and can only be reopened with the passphrase below.

vault phrase of badup-hahig = tamael-aldael-kelmir-istael-fenok-istwyn-tamius-jorath-oliion

## Introduce per-tenant rate quotas in the Orvane gateway

For the release manager: this change replaces our global throttle with per-tenant quotas, resolved at request time from the tenant registry and cached for sixty seconds. Tenants without an explicit quota inherit the tier default; overage returns a retryable status with a hint header. Rollout is gated behind a flag, defaulting off, and the old throttle remains as a backstop until two clean release cycles pass.

The initial tier defaults we intend to ship are listed below.

limits module of taguf-hafog:
WEIGHTS = {
    "wenox": 690,
    "wenok": 782,
    "kelax": 41,
    "holox": 338,
    "quenir": 39,
}

# Break-Glass: Catalog Cache Invalidation

Scope: the Pinrow product catalog at Veldstone Retail. If stale prices persist after a purge and the Hollowmere invalidation queue is wedged, use break-glass to flush the edge tier directly. Contractors: get verbal sign-off from the catalog lead first. Steps: open the Hollowmere admin shell, select emergency-flush, confirm the tenant, and run it once — repeated flushes thrash the origin. Access is logged and expires after 20 minutes. Unseal the admin shell with the passphrase below.

recovery phrase for kahop-tajog: istix-casvan